A product is made of two key components: Component A, which has a random failure rate of three in every twenty hours of operation; and Component B, which has a random failure rate of two in every ten hours. PLEASE SHOW YOUR WORK

1. What is the reliability of Component A? 2. What is the reliability of the Component B? 3. What is the probability that the product will perform reliably for one hour? 4. If an identical backup is added for Component B, with a switch that is 100% reliable, what is the probability that the product will perform reliably for one hour? 5. If both Components A and B have identical backups with switches that are .95 reliable, what is the reliability of the product?
